Step 1: Choose the Right Software
Before you can start using a 3D viewer, you'll need to select the right software for your needs. There are many options available, such as Blender, SketchUp, or Autodesk Fusion 360. Once you've chosen a software that suits your requirements, you can proceed to the next step.
Step 2: Import Your 3D Model
Once you have your 3D modeling software installed, it's time to import your 3D model into the program. Most software allows you to do this by simply clicking on 'File' and then 'Import.' Select your 3D model file and open it within the software.
Step 3: Navigate and Manipulate the 3D Model
Now that your 3D model is loaded, you can start navigating and manipulating it within the 3D viewer. Use the mouse to rotate, pan, and zoom in on the model to get a better view from different angles. This will help you inspect the details of the model and understand its structure.
Step 4: Customize Your Viewing Experience
Many 3D viewers offer additional features to enhance your viewing experience. You can adjust lighting, apply different textures or materials, and even animate the model to see how it moves in a virtual space. Experiment with these tools to customize the look and feel of your 3D model.
Step 5: Save and Export Your Work
Once you've finished exploring and customizing your 3D model, you can save your progress and export the model for further use. Most software provides options for saving your work in various formats, such as .obj, .stl, or .fbx, depending on your specific needs.
